Who is Celimax?

Celimax is a Korean skincare brand with a focus on transparency. By designing honest, user friendly cosmetics with clean ingredients, Celimax creates products with efficacy that deliver better skin.

First let’s talk about noni. What is that? Noni or also known as morinda citrifolia fruit extract is full of nutrients including vitamins, minerals, and amino acids. I have never seen any Korean brands using this extract before so I’m curious to see what it’ll offer to the skin.

The Real Noni Energy Ampoule Mist

I used to think that a mist is something I don’t particularly need in my routine until I tried one and I was hooked. This has a very fine mist and I really like using this right before toner. This keeps my skin hydrated until I’m ready for the next step.

Did you know it’s not a good thing to leave your skin without any moisture for too long after cleansing your face? Yes that’s right. Try not to leave your skin bare for too long after the first step and before the second step in your routine so this is where a mist comes in handy.

Ingredients highlight:

Noni (Morinda Citrifolia) Fruit Extract (81.67%) – A world renowned superfood, this fruit extract is full of nutrients including vitamins, minerals, and amino acids. Antioxidants provide anti-aging benefits and improve dull skin tone.

Tangerine Peel Extract – Contains keratin which provides a refreshing sensation and strengthens the skin’s barrier. Protects skin against free radicals.

Hydrolyzed Hyaluronic Acid – The smallest form of hyaluronic particle, effectively penetrates deeply into skin layers for long lasting hydration.

Copper Tripeptide-1 – Heals skin and stimulates collagen production, improving signs of aging.

The Real Noni Moisture Balancing Toner

As someone who has normal towards oily skin, I prefer something that is lightweight & fast absorbing and this product has exactly what I’m looking for in a toner. It has a pH of 4.5 – 5.5 which makes it perfect as a balancing toner. I have been using this toner in both morning and night routines but I especially love it in the morning routine because it absorbs very fast without leaving sticky or greasy residue and it has a lovely hydrating properties too which I prefer in the morning as some products tend to make my face feels oily towards the end of the day so I really focus on lightweight products in the morning.

This is also great for the layering method and I personally love layering this up to 3-4 layers in my night routine. It’s definitely more on the watery side which is why I love this in the morning.

Ingredients highlight:

Noni (Morinda Citrifolia) Fruit Extract (80.1%) – A world renowned superfood, this fruit extract boasts over 300 types of nutrients including vitamins, minerals, and amino acids. Antioxidants provide anti-aging benefits and improve dull skin tone.

Amino Acid Complex – Strengthens skin’s moisture barrier by balancing and retaining hydration level. Improves skin texture.

The Real Noni Energy Ampoule

This is the product that introduces me to Celimax. So many people raved about this ampoule and it got me intrigued about noni in general. This ampoule is more on the thicker side but it’s not too thick to the extent it’s hard to pick up with the dropper wand. The consistency is a bit goopy with gel-like texture but it spreads very easily since it has a slippery viscosity.

I personally prefer using this at night because it can feel a bit heavy in the morning and it is highly moisturizing. I think this is perfect for a minimalist because you really don’t need to use anything extra in your routine besides this ampoule and finish it off with a moisturizer. A full dropper and a half is enough for one usage and the bottle will probably last me two months with consistent uses.

Ingredients highlight:

Noni (Morinda Citrifolia) Fruit Extract (71.77%) – A world renowned superfood, this fruit extract boasts over 300 types of nutrients including vitamins,minerals, and amino acids. Antioxidants provide anti-aging benefits and improve dull skin tone.

Adenosine – Soothes and restores the surface of the skin. Helps diminish fine lines and wrinkles, improving skin texture.

The Real Noni Refresh Clay Mask

This is not only a regular clay mask but also offers a mild exfoliation with finely powdered dried fruit noni. This doesn’t dry out my skin and my face feels really soft after using it. My enlarged pores also look smooth and refined. I love the fact that it doesn’t dry out too fast while doing a great job at removing the excessive sebum from my skin. The clay mask itself has a deep green-ish color and it looks a bit suspicious (lol) but I can assure you it smells just fine.

Interestingly, you can also use this to deep cleanse. As suggested from the website, here’s how to do it:

For an alternative use as a purifying deep cleanser, mix The Real Noni Refresh Clay Mask with a cleansing foam or gel in 1:2 ratio (clay mask 1: cleanser 2) for deep pore cleansing or masking.

I haven’t personally tried this method yet but I’ll make sure to update this post once I did.

Ingredients highlight:

Noni (Morinda Citrifolia) Fruit Extract (30%) – A world renowned superfood, this fruit extract boasts over 300 types of nutrients including vitamins,minerals, and amino acids. Antioxidants provide anti-aging benefits and improve dull skin tone.

Kaolin & bentonite – Effective at removing excessive sebum, dead skin cells, and impurities from clogged pores.

The Real Noni Energy Repair Cream

This a thick cream moisturizer that is targeted for dry and damaged skin however I have normal to oily skin and my skin absolutely love this cream. Upon trying the texture on my hand at first I thought it’s going to be too heavy for me but the cream melts beautifully on my skin and I wake up with soft, well moisturized skin. You know the effect you’d get whenever you’re using sleeping mask/pack? That’s what I get from using this cream.

That being said, I definitely prefer this at night because of its consistency and it is highly moisturizing for me to use in the morning. But if you live in colder country, this may be a lovely morning moisturizer for you. I wish this comes in a bigger tube because I’ll probably finish this 50ml in a couple of months.

Ingredients highlight:

Noni (Morinda Citrifolia) Fruit Extract (55%) – A world renowned superfood, this fruit extract boasts over 300 types of nutrients including vitamins,minerals, and amino acids. Antioxidants provide anti-aging benefits and improve dull skin tone.

Noni (Morinda Citrifolia) Seed Oil (1%) – Soothe and moisturize dry, damaged skin.

Ceramide – Strengthen moisture barrier and help prevent water loss from skin.

Adenosine – KFDA-certified functional ingredient for wrinkle improvement.
